Terrence J. Stobbe is a scholar working on Social Psychology, Pharmacology and Orthopedics and Sports Medicine. According to data from OpenAlex, Terrence J. Stobbe has authored 27 papers receiving a total of 432 indexed citations (citations by other indexed papers that have themselves been cited), including 11 papers in Social Psychology, 5 papers in Pharmacology and 4 papers in Orthopedics and Sports Medicine. Recurrent topics in Terrence J. Stobbe's work include Ergonomics and Musculoskeletal Disorders (6 papers), Musculoskeletal pain and rehabilitation (5 papers) and Human-Automation Interaction and Safety (4 papers). Terrence J. Stobbe is often cited by papers focused on Ergonomics and Musculoskeletal Disorders (6 papers), Musculoskeletal pain and rehabilitation (5 papers) and Human-Automation Interaction and Safety (4 papers). Terrence J. Stobbe collaborates with scholars based in United States, Canada and Saudi Arabia. Terrence J. Stobbe's co-authors include Ziqing Zhuang, Gerald R. Hobbs, Hongwei Hsiao, James W. Collins, Dennis L. Hart, Michael D. Attfield, Roger C. Jensen, Yves Beauchamp, Warren R. Myers and Daniel Imbeau and has published in prestigious journals such as Spine, Physical Therapy and Human Factors The Journal of the Human Factors and Ergonomics Society.
